To solve this problem, we must remember that the formula for area of a square is given by A = s^2, where s represents the length of one of the sides.
Since we are given that the area of the square is 36, we can substitute this into the formula to get:
36 = s^2
Then, to solve for s, we should take the square root of both sides, which gives us:
s = 6
